Description
Original print is damaged.
Photograph caption dated November 3, 1956 reads "Vladimir Chernik, Valley Times' undecided first voter, listens closely to advice from one of many readers who telephoned him after story appeared explaining his predicament. He'll accept more calls today, will give readers full report Monday." The Valley Times is headquartered in North Hollywood.
